Ex Uganda Cranes international, Nateete Hot stars, Coffee Sports Club, and KCC GC right winger, Obadiah Semakula dubbed ‘Musanvu W’eggwanga’ has been seriously I’ll for quite some time at his homestead of Nabisaalu zone, Lukuli(Makindye) since he was diagnosed with Hernia, though previously he had received treatment at Mild May Clinic.

Before his ailment, he had been working at Peacock Paints Limited a company owned by former Buganda Kingdom sports minister Kaddu Kiberu Semakula based on 7th street industrial area.

He acquired the name ‘Musanvu W’eggwanga’ because of using that phrase when he used to court girls in his hey days whereby he could send young boys to tell ladies.

“Oyo omuwala, mugambe musanvu w’eggwanga amwetaaga”

The ex Cranes star made his national team debut way back in 1982 during the CECAFA Senior Challenge Cup against Malawi.

Semakula is ranked as the best amongst the greatest crossers of the ball in Ugandan football and he only won one league trophy in his glittering football career in 1997.
